Implementasi Konsep Context Awareness pada Aplikasi Pengingat Ibadah Sunnah di Platform Android Muhammad Zaki Nabil; Agi Putra Kharisma; Issa Arwani
Jurnal Pengembangan Teknologi Informasi dan Ilmu Komputer Vol 4 No 10 (2020): Oktober 2020
Publisher : Fakultas Ilmu Komputer (FILKOM), Universitas Brawijaya

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

The use of applications installed on smartphones, especially Android, is currently very much used by a Muslim or Muslimah to support prayer activities. One of them is a reminder application for prayer. However, most application reminders are intended only for prayer that is compulsory while the sunnah prayer activities are still relatively small. Another disadvantage is that the application is not able to automatically provide reminders to users that are adjusted to the location, time and activity of the user whether they have performed the prayer or not. For that we need a context-aware concept that is expected to be able to optimize the reminder function so that the application can provide reminders according to user activities. By utilizing context information in the form of location, time, identity and activity of the user through the sensors that are on the smartphone, the application can find out whether the user has carried out prayer or not. Sensors that can be utilized include GPS sensors, proximity sensors, light sensors and accelerometer sensors. The level of efficiency of the use of the application was tested using usability testing and it was found that SUS score of 74 included in good qualifications and success, then in compatibility testing the Sunnah prayer reminders application can run smoothly and there was no error in the Android operating system Lollipop, Marshmallow, Nougat, and Oreo.
Pengembangan Aplikasi Penyesuai Playlist Musik dengan Konsep Geofencing menggunakan Spotify API Berbasis Android Fachri Rachmanda; Agi Putra Kharisma; Wibisono Sukmo Wardhono
Jurnal Pengembangan Teknologi Informasi dan Ilmu Komputer Vol 4 No 10 (2020): Oktober 2020
Publisher : Fakultas Ilmu Komputer (FILKOM), Universitas Brawijaya

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Listening to music is one of the biggest uses of smartphones, because certain music is considered to be able to affect mood and mind in carrying out various activities. One of the most popular music listening service providers is Spotify, which currently does not provide location-based music playback services. Therefore an application development for Android-based smartphones is conducted to adjust the playback of the type of music from Spotify based on the user's activities with the location as a reference for the adjustment. This application applies the concept of geofencing which is implemented with the Java programming language on the Android SDK (Software Development Kit). The results of functional testing with black box testing show that the function of this application has fulfilled the main functional needs of the system in adjusting the playlist and complementary functions that support the main function. In the usability test using the SUS (System Usability Scale) method involving ten respondents obtained 60.75% results or included in the category of "Poor" which can be concluded that the application has not been fully accepted by users so it still needs to be developed for the better.

Perbandingan Kinerja Pola Perancangan MVC, MVP, dan MVVM Pada Aplikasi Berbasis Android (Studi kasus : Aplikasi Laporan Hasil Belajar Siswa SMA BSS) Bahrur Rizki Putra Surya; Agi Putra Kharisma; Novanto Yudistira
Jurnal Pengembangan Teknologi Informasi dan Ilmu Komputer Vol 4 No 11 (2020): November 2020
Publisher : Fakultas Ilmu Komputer (FILKOM), Universitas Brawijaya

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Laporan hasil belajar is a system that regulates student learning outcomes reporting at Brawijaya Smart School. This system can display grades from students in android application form. The need for efficiency in an android application is very necessary to achieve user satisfaction, and the need for knowledge of the design patterns needed to build or develop an android application. There are several design patterns that are used to build or develop an application, including Model View Controller, Model View Presenter, and Model View View Model. The design pattern will be applied to the laporan hasil belajar application to compare which design patterns are most efficient for laporan hasil belajar application. The initial stage for this research is engineering needs, at this stage gives the results of 4 (four) functional needs and 2 (two) non-functional needs, these needs are used as a basis for designing and implementing. The implementation is carried out by applying the design pattern of Model View Controller, Model View Presenter, and Model View View Model with the java programming language. Furthermore, after the implementation phase, the testing phase will be carried out on each application that has applied the design pattern of the Model View Controller, Model View Presenter, and Model View View Model 5 (five) times with the same results on energy use medium and memory usage average of 59.7MB for MVC, 59MB for MVP and 73.2MB for MVVM. The functional testing by using the blackbox testing method gives 100% validity in all functions
